**Runbook: Nightly Inventory Reconciliation (Stockmender)**

Heads up, future maintainer: the Stockmender recon job runs at 02:15 and diffs warehouse counts against the Ledgerbin totals. If it dies midway, just rerun it — it's idempotent, promise. Logs land in `/var/log/stockmender/`. Before rerunning on a fresh box, copy `env.sample` to `.env` and fill in the queue credentials. Then add this line for the Ledgerbin write token:

env line for kaguf-hahop: COURIER_KEY29=2e2fa9479f98362396e2c28f86fc9

Q: My door sensor was recalled — can I still get in? A: Yes. Sensors on Floors 2 and 5 of Ashgrove Court are being swapped by Relith Controls this fortnight. Affected doors are on manual keypad mode until the swap is done. Report any sensor with a red sticker to the works desk. For the interim keypad entry, use the code below.

turnstile pass: bdg-JVSWH-52711

## Canary Gating Environment Variables

Rollmeter evaluates canary gates using `GATE_ERROR_BUDGET` and `GATE_BAKE_MINUTES`, both read at deploy time. On-call engineers should never edit these mid-bake; abort and restart instead. The gate evaluator also authenticates to the metrics backend, and that credential is set on the line directly below.

env line for fafof-fahag: LEDGER_TOKEN5=f8790